Abstract
Many naturally occurring indoles possess important biological activity.'-'On the other hand, synthetic indoles with substituents at various positions have been used extensively in medicine and pharmacology?* 6* 6 as well as in ho1ography. l Thus, the development of new, efficient method~ l-'*~-~ o that lead to indoles is necessary. Herein, we report two novel methods for the synthesis of indoles which allow easy functionaliiation at almost all ...
